Carrillo's Carpet, C-15 Flooring and Floor Covering Contractor in Burlingame, CA
Carrillo's Carpet operating as a sole owner holds an active California contractor license (CSLB #968584), valid through Dec 31, 2027. First issued in 2011, the license has been on the CSLB roster for 15 years. It carries a single CSLB classification: C-15 — Flooring and Floor Covering Contractor. Records show an active surety bond on file with Nationwide Mutual Insurance Company and an exempt workers' compensation status (no employees on payroll). The business is based in Burlingame, in San Mateo County, California.
